Just one year ago, Laura Patterson survived a stroke – and this weekend she completed the Disneyland Half Marathon! After learning to walk again, Laura went on to running and hasn’t stopped – all the way through the finish line this past Sunday. Watch her triumphant finish alongside her coach and friends.
